Live resin, live rosin, hash rosin, distillate, budder, people use these words like they mean the same thing, and they don't. Quick breakdown: distillate is stripped down and then has flavor added back in later. Live resin starts from frozen flower and goes straight into a solvent-based extraction. Hash rosin skips solvents entirely. Growers wash the frozen flower in ice water, which separates out the trichomes (the tiny resin heads) into what's called bubble hash. Only after that, heat and pressure turn that hash into rosin. No chemicals touch it at any point. Pineapple Express existed before 2008. The film just made an already-real strain a household name. Since then, it's stuck around on shelves for almost 20 years, which says a lot considering how many strains come and go in a year. The genetics behind it: Trainwreck crossed with Hawaiian. Trainwreck brings the sharp, racy, pine-and-pepper side. Hawaiian brings the sweet tropical fruit. Cross those two and you get exactly what the name promises. Caryophyllene adds a peppery, spicy note. Limonene brings the sharp citrus lift. That candy-sweet tropical scent is ocimene doing its job. And myrcene, if it's present in the batch, keeps the energy grounded instead of scattered. Some batches finish with a soft coconut taste, which isn't something you'd expect from a strain named after pineapple. Nothing here is sprayed on after extraction, it's all from the plant itself. A big chunk of users describe it as energetic, upbeat, talkative, a good daytime pick. But just as many describe the opposite, calm, heavy, almost sedating. Neither side is lying. Phenotype (the specific genetic version a grower runs), harvest timing, and cure all shift how a strain feels, even under the same label. Add concentrate format on top of that, since dabbing kicks in quicker and harder than smoking flower does. Every time the jar's open, heat, light, and air chip away at the flavor. Keep it in the fridge or somewhere cool and dark. Don't leave the lid off longer than you need to. Some people split off a small daily amount into a second jar so the main one stays sealed most of the time.
